The Impacts of Keratin 17 on the Excretion of IFN-γ and the Proliferation of T Lymphocytes from Patients with Psoriasis

Abstract: Objective To investigate the immunological effects of human keratin 17 (K17) on T lymphocytes from psoriatic patients.Methods Total RNA was extracted from the epidermis of psoriatic lesions,and mRNA was reversely transcribed to cDNA.The K17 gene was amplified by PCR and inserted into pGEX-4T-1 expression vector,and then K17 was expressed and purified.T cells were isolated and purified by gra-dient centrifugation and AET-SRBC (2-aminoethylosothiouronium bromide-treated sheep red blood cells) precipitation.MTT assay and direct cell counting method were used to detect the proliferation of T cells.The concentration of IFN-γ in culture supernatant was measured by ELISA.Results Compared with the control group,K17 significantly enhanced the proliferation of T cells from psoriatic patients and increased the expression level of IFN-γ(P<0.001 respectively).Conclusion K17 can enhance the function of T cells in psoriatic patients,and it may play a role as an autoantigen in the immunological pathogenesis of psoriasis.
